# $NetBSD: Makefile,v 1.34 2025/06/06 23:10:26 wiz Exp $

DISTNAME=		lowdown-2.0.2
CATEGORIES=		textproc
MASTER_SITES=		${MASTER_SITE_GITHUB:=kristapsdz/}
GITHUB_TAG=		refs/tags/VERSION_${PKGVERSION_NOREV:S/./_/g}

MAINTAINER=		pkgsrc-users@NetBSD.org
HOMEPAGE=		https://kristaps.bsd.lv/lowdown/
COMMENT=		Simple Markdown translator
LICENSE=		isc

WRKSRC=			${WRKDIR}/${PKGBASE}-${GITHUB_TAG:C/.*\///}

HAS_CONFIGURE=		yes
USE_LIBTOOL=		yes

SUBST_CLASSES+=		install
SUBST_SED.install=	-e 's|/usr/local|${PREFIX}|'
SUBST_SED.install+=	-e 's|^MANDIR=.*|MANDIR=${PREFIX}/${PKGMANDIR}|'
SUBST_SED.install+=	-e '/^CC=.*/d'
SUBST_SED.install+=	-e '/^CFLAGS=.*/d'
SUBST_SED.install+=	-e '/^LDFLAGS=.*/d'
SUBST_FILES.install+=	configure
SUBST_STAGE.install=	pre-configure
SUBST_MESSAGE.install=	Fixing installation path.

INSTALL_TARGET=		install install_pkgsrc

TEST_TARGET=		regress

pre-configure:
	${ECHO} HAVE_SANDBOX_INIT=0 >> ${WRKSRC}/configure.local

.include "../../mk/bsd.pkg.mk"
